This resort is highly regarded for its spacious units and stunning views overlooking the Colorado River and Lake Marble Falls, making it a memorable destination. Its prime location serves as an excellent base for explorers eager to discover the Texas Hill Country, including its numerous wineries, state parks, and caverns, as well as for day trips to Austin and San Antonio. The property is particularly well-suited for families seeking comfortable, well-equipped accommodations and for couples looking for a relaxing getaway with picturesque scenery. Guests consistently praise the overall cleanliness and the helpfulness of the staff. To enhance your stay, consider requesting a top-floor unit to minimize potential noise from above, and be aware that some buildings do not have elevators, which is important for guests with mobility considerations.
Facilities & Amenities
Guests appreciate the range of amenities available, including a well-maintained heated pool, a hot tub with scenic views, and a cozy fire pit area. The resort also features a game room with a pool table and shuffleboard, and a functional fitness center for those wishing to stay active. Many units come equipped with in-room laundry facilities and full kitchens, providing convenience for longer stays. However, it is important to note that only a few buildings are equipped with elevators, meaning many units require navigating stairs. A recurring point of feedback is the policy of charging for Wi-Fi, which many guests find inconvenient and an unexpected expense in modern accommodations.

Dining & Food Quality
The resort does not feature on-site restaurants or food stores, which is a key aspect of its design. Instead, guests benefit from fully equipped kitchens within their units, complete with dishes, silverware, and appliances, allowing for convenient self-catering. This setup is highly appreciated by those who prefer to prepare their own meals. For dining out, the property's location offers easy access to a variety of local dining options in Marble Falls, including popular spots like the Blue Bonnet Cafe, and nearby grocery stores such as H-E-B for stocking up on essentials. The emphasis is on providing a comfortable, home-like environment for guests to manage their own culinary needs.
Location & Accessibility
The resort boasts an excellent location for exploring the wider Texas Hill Country. It provides convenient access to numerous wineries, antique shops, and state parks, including Longhorn Caverns. Day trips to larger cities like Austin and San Antonio are also easily manageable, typically within an hour or two's drive. Situated on a hilly terrain overlooking the lake, the property offers great views. However, guests should be aware that a car is essential for getting around, as the resort is not within walking distance of downtown Marble Falls, and there are limited sidewalks. The multi-level layout means many units involve navigating stairs, and while parking is generally ample and convenient, the steep driveways can be challenging.

Additional Information
A significant point of discussion among guests revolves around the timeshare presentations offered on-site. While some guests reported a low-pressure experience, many found these sessions to be lengthy, aggressive, and disruptive to their vacation, with some even mentioning unauthorized credit checks or reservation issues tied to these presentations, including instances of overbooking and last-minute cancellations. Another frequently mentioned detail is the paid Wi-Fi policy, which is a source of frustration for many who expect complimentary internet access. On a more positive note, the resort occasionally hosts unique activities, such as an astronomer providing stargazing sessions, adding a special touch to the guest experience.
